- // Package jaeger contains an OpenCensus tracing exporter for Jaeger.
- package jaeger // import "go.opencensus.io/exporter/jaeger"
-
- import (
- "bytes"
- "encoding/binary"
- "errors"
- "fmt"
- "io"
- "io/ioutil"
- "log"
- "net/http"
-
- "github.com/apache/thrift/lib/go/thrift"
- gen "go.opencensus.io/exporter/jaeger/internal/gen-go/jaeger"
- "go.opencensus.io/trace"
- "google.golang.org/api/support/bundler"
- )
-
- const defaultServiceName = "OpenCensus"
-
- // Options are the options to be used when initializing a Jaeger exporter.
- type Options struct {
- // Endpoint is the Jaeger HTTP Thrift endpoint.
- // For example, http://localhost:14268.
- //
- // Deprecated: Use CollectorEndpoint instead.
- Endpoint string
-
- // CollectorEndpoint is the full url to the Jaeger HTTP Thrift collector.
- // For example, http://localhost:14268/api/traces
- CollectorEndpoint string
-
- // AgentEndpoint instructs exporter to send spans to jaeger-agent at this address.
- // For example, localhost:6831.
- AgentEndpoint string
-
- // OnError is the hook to be called when there is
- // an error occurred when uploading the stats data.
- // If no custom hook is set, errors are logged.
- // Optional.
- OnError func(err error)
-
- // Username to be used if basic auth is required.
- // Optional.
- Username string
-
- // Password to be used if basic auth is required.
- // Optional.
- Password string
-
- // ServiceName is the Jaeger service name.
- // Deprecated: Specify Process instead.
- ServiceName string
-
- // Process contains the information about the exporting process.
- Process Process
-
- //BufferMaxCount defines the total number of traces that can be buffered in memory
- BufferMaxCount int
- }
-
- // NewExporter returns a trace.Exporter implementation that exports
- // the collected spans to Jaeger.
- func NewExporter(o Options) (*Exporter, error) {
- if o.Endpoint == "" && o.CollectorEndpoint == "" && o.AgentEndpoint == "" {
- return nil, errors.New("missing endpoint for Jaeger exporter")
- }
-
- var endpoint string
- var client *agentClientUDP
- var err error
- if o.Endpoint != "" {
- endpoint = o.Endpoint + "/api/traces?format=jaeger.thrift"
- log.Printf("Endpoint has been deprecated. Please use CollectorEndpoint instead.")
- } else if o.CollectorEndpoint != "" {
- endpoint = o.CollectorEndpoint
- } else {
- client, err = newAgentClientUDP(o.AgentEndpoint, udpPacketMaxLength)
- if err != nil {
- return nil, err
- }
- }
- onError := func(err error) {
- if o.OnError != nil {
- o.OnError(err)
- return
- }
- log.Printf("Error when uploading spans to Jaeger: %v", err)
- }
- service := o.Process.ServiceName
- if service == "" && o.ServiceName != "" {
- // fallback to old service name if specified
- service = o.ServiceName
- } else if service == "" {
- service = defaultServiceName
- }
- tags := make([]*gen.Tag, len(o.Process.Tags))
- for i, tag := range o.Process.Tags {
- tags[i] = attributeToTag(tag.key, tag.value)
- }
- e := &Exporter{
- endpoint: endpoint,
- agentEndpoint: o.AgentEndpoint,
- client: client,
- username: o.Username,
- password: o.Password,
- process: &gen.Process{
- ServiceName: service,
- Tags: tags,
- },
- }
- bundler := bundler.NewBundler((*gen.Span)(nil), func(bundle interface{}) {
- if err := e.upload(bundle.([]*gen.Span)); err != nil {
- onError(err)
- }
- })
-
- // Set BufferedByteLimit with the total number of spans that are permissible to be held in memory.
- // This needs to be done since the size of messages is always set to 1. Failing to set this would allow
- // 1G messages to be held in memory since that is the default value of BufferedByteLimit.
- if o.BufferMaxCount != 0 {
- bundler.BufferedByteLimit = o.BufferMaxCount
- }
-
- e.bundler = bundler
- return e, nil
- }

- // Process contains the information exported to jaeger about the source
- // of the trace data.
- type Process struct {
- // ServiceName is the Jaeger service name.
- ServiceName string
-
- // Tags are added to Jaeger Process exports
- Tags []Tag
- }
-
- // Tag defines a key-value pair
- // It is limited to the possible conversions to *jaeger.Tag by attributeToTag
- type Tag struct {
- key string
- value interface{}
- }
-
- // BoolTag creates a new tag of type bool, exported as jaeger.TagType_BOOL
- func BoolTag(key string, value bool) Tag {
- return Tag{key, value}
- }
-
- // StringTag creates a new tag of type string, exported as jaeger.TagType_STRING
- func StringTag(key string, value string) Tag {
- return Tag{key, value}
- }
-
- // Int64Tag creates a new tag of type int64, exported as jaeger.TagType_LONG
- func Int64Tag(key string, value int64) Tag {
- return Tag{key, value}
- }
-
- // Exporter is an implementation of trace.Exporter that uploads spans to Jaeger.
- type Exporter struct {
- endpoint string
- agentEndpoint string
- process *gen.Process
- bundler *bundler.Bundler
- client *agentClientUDP
-
- username, password string
- }
-
- var _ trace.Exporter = (*Exporter)(nil)
-
- // ExportSpan exports a SpanData to Jaeger.
- func (e *Exporter) ExportSpan(data *trace.SpanData) {
- e.bundler.Add(spanDataToThrift(data), 1)
- // TODO(jbd): Handle oversized bundlers.
- }
-
- // As per the OpenCensus Status code mapping in
- // https://opencensus.io/tracing/span/status/
- // the status is OK if the code is 0.
- const opencensusStatusCodeOK = 0
-
- func spanDataToThrift(data *trace.SpanData) *gen.Span {
- tags := make([]*gen.Tag, 0, len(data.Attributes))
- for k, v := range data.Attributes {
- tag := attributeToTag(k, v)
- if tag != nil {
- tags = append(tags, tag)
- }
- }
-
- tags = append(tags,
- attributeToTag("status.code", data.Status.Code),
- attributeToTag("status.message", data.Status.Message),
- )
-
- // Ensure that if Status.Code is not OK, that we set the "error" tag on the Jaeger span.
- // See Issue https://github.com/census-instrumentation/opencensus-go/issues/1041
- if data.Status.Code != opencensusStatusCodeOK {
- tags = append(tags, attributeToTag("error", true))
- }
-
- var logs []*gen.Log
- for _, a := range data.Annotations {
- fields := make([]*gen.Tag, 0, len(a.Attributes))
- for k, v := range a.Attributes {
- tag := attributeToTag(k, v)
- if tag != nil {
- fields = append(fields, tag)
- }
- }
- fields = append(fields, attributeToTag("message", a.Message))
- logs = append(logs, &gen.Log{
- Timestamp: a.Time.UnixNano() / 1000,
- Fields: fields,
- })
- }
- var refs []*gen.SpanRef
- for _, link := range data.Links {
- refs = append(refs, &gen.SpanRef{
- TraceIdHigh: bytesToInt64(link.TraceID[0:8]),
- TraceIdLow: bytesToInt64(link.TraceID[8:16]),
- SpanId: bytesToInt64(link.SpanID[:]),
- })
- }
- return &gen.Span{
- TraceIdHigh: bytesToInt64(data.TraceID[0:8]),
- TraceIdLow: bytesToInt64(data.TraceID[8:16]),
- SpanId: bytesToInt64(data.SpanID[:]),
- ParentSpanId: bytesToInt64(data.ParentSpanID[:]),
- OperationName: name(data),
- Flags: int32(data.TraceOptions),
- StartTime: data.StartTime.UnixNano() / 1000,
- Duration: data.EndTime.Sub(data.StartTime).Nanoseconds() / 1000,
- Tags: tags,
- Logs: logs,
- References: refs,
- }
- }
-
- func name(sd *trace.SpanData) string {
- n := sd.Name
- switch sd.SpanKind {
- case trace.SpanKindClient:
- n = "Sent." + n
- case trace.SpanKindServer:
- n = "Recv." + n
- }
- return n
- }
-
- func attributeToTag(key string, a interface{}) *gen.Tag {
- var tag *gen.Tag
- switch value := a.(type) {
- case bool:
- tag = &gen.Tag{
- Key: key,
- VBool: &value,
- VType: gen.TagType_BOOL,
- }
- case string:
- tag = &gen.Tag{
- Key: key,
- VStr: &value,
- VType: gen.TagType_STRING,
- }
- case int64:
- tag = &gen.Tag{
- Key: key,
- VLong: &value,
- VType: gen.TagType_LONG,
- }
- case int32:
- v := int64(value)
- tag = &gen.Tag{
- Key: key,
- VLong: &v,
- VType: gen.TagType_LONG,
- }
- case float64:
- v := float64(value)
- tag = &gen.Tag{
- Key: key,
- VDouble: &v,
- VType: gen.TagType_DOUBLE,
- }
- }
- return tag
- }
-
- // Flush waits for exported trace spans to be uploaded.
- //
- // This is useful if your program is ending and you do not want to lose recent spans.
- func (e *Exporter) Flush() {
- e.bundler.Flush()
- }
-
- func (e *Exporter) upload(spans []*gen.Span) error {
- batch := &gen.Batch{
- Spans: spans,
- Process: e.process,
- }
- if e.endpoint != "" {
- return e.uploadCollector(batch)
- }
- return e.uploadAgent(batch)
- }
-
- func (e *Exporter) uploadAgent(batch *gen.Batch) error {
- return e.client.EmitBatch(batch)
- }
-
- func (e *Exporter) uploadCollector(batch *gen.Batch) error {
- body, err := serialize(batch)
- if err != nil {
- return err
- }
- req, err := http.NewRequest("POST", e.endpoint, body)
- if err != nil {
- return err
- }
- if e.username != "" && e.password != "" {
- req.SetBasicAuth(e.username, e.password)
- }
- req.Header.Set("Content-Type", "application/x-thrift")
-
- resp, err := http.DefaultClient.Do(req)
- if err != nil {
- return err
- }
-
- io.Copy(ioutil.Discard, resp.Body)
- resp.Body.Close()
-
- if resp.StatusCode < 200 || resp.StatusCode >= 300 {
- return fmt.Errorf("failed to upload traces; HTTP status code: %d", resp.StatusCode)
- }
- return nil
- }
-
- func serialize(obj thrift.TStruct) (*bytes.Buffer, error) {
- buf := thrift.NewTMemoryBuffer()
- if err := obj.Write(thrift.NewTBinaryProtocolTransport(buf)); err != nil {
- return nil, err
- }
- return buf.Buffer, nil
- }
-
- func bytesToInt64(buf []byte) int64 {
- u := binary.BigEndian.Uint64(buf)
- return int64(u)
- }
